Front of House - Bartenders & Floor Team Members

£12.71 per hour + tips (approx. £3,000-£5,000 per year) + staff perks

The newest addition to Craft Locals is under extensive renovations and will open in March 2026. Located on the outskirts of Rickmansworth, just a short walk from the Aquadrome and Bishop's Wood Country Park, The Rose & Crown is a welcoming country pub with deep local roots and a bright new chapter ahead. Perfectly placed for locals, walkers and visitors alike, it's a pub designed for relaxed pints, great food and good company.

Inside you'll find a proper pub atmosphere, with a carefully curated range of real ales and thoughtfully chosen wines, supported by fresh, seasonal food and excellent, friendly service. The kitchen delivers fresh, seasonal menus built around classic pub favourites, using quality ingredients and contemporary touches. On Sundays the focus is on exceptional roasts, with perfectly cooked meats, crisp unlimited roast potatoes, seasonal veg and rich gravies worth coming back for.

With outdoor seating for warmer days, a strong sense of community and a passion for great hospitality, The Rose & Crown is a pub where locals return time and again - a place to eat well, drink better and feel at home.

What's in it for you
  • Pay: £12.71/hr + tips worth approx. £3,000-£5,000/year
  • Perks: 50% off food & 20% off drinks across the group, 28 days holiday, sharers, socials, staff discount
  • Tips: Great card tips shared fairly across the team
  • Training: Supplier tastings, brewery visits, WSET opportunities, and weekly product training
  • Fun: A lively workplace with plenty of laughter and team spirit
  • Career path: Clear progression into Team Leader and management roles
What you'll be doing
  • Greeting and seating guests with a warm welcome
  • Taking food and drink orders confidently and accurately
  • Serving drinks quickly, efficiently and with great presentation
  • Knowing the menus inside out and recommending dishes and drinks
  • Keeping the bar, floor and guest areas clean and organised
  • Creating memorable guest experiences every shift
What we're looking for
  • Experience in pubs, bars or restaurants as bar or floor team member
  • A people person with energy, confidence and positivity
  • Passion for hospitality, service and working in a team
  • Willingness to learn all aspects of front of house and develop skills
  • Availability to work evenings and weekends
  • Bonus: knowledge or enthusiasm for craft beer and quality drinks
